I have XMAIL 1.12 running on Linux. I have multiple domains configured on the server.
I understand that it is possible via SMTP.IPMAP.TAB to configure which IP's can connect to the server via SMTP. However, is it possible to configure XMAIL so that only x.x.x.x/24 can send SMTP mail to domain-a.com and only y.y.y.y/24 can send SMTP to domain-b.com? The reason I ask, is that one of my clients is trying out POSTINI, and they are supposed to allow only two /24's to connect. I have a shared server, so if I configured the smtp.ipmap.tab file, It would be a global change, I just need it to affect one domain. Is this possible? I am currently doing this via IPTABLES but thought it may be easier if there was something in xmail that allowed this. Any ideas? Thanks!
